Retaining Walls

Retaining walls are structures built to hold back soil, primarily in the form of a pile. These walls can be constructed of timber, interlocking steel, or vinyl panels, and are driven into the ground to the required depth. The soil at the base of the wall anchors the piles. Retaining walls usually have a third of their piles above ground level, while the other two-thirds are below. The piles must resist the bending forces induced by retained materials.

Block & Brick Walls

Block & brick walls are common construction methods that use concrete and reinforced blocks to form a solid wall. Concrete blocks can also be hollow so reinforcing bars can be installed. Stretcher units fit into the primary part of a wall while adjoining units cover the outer edges. Concrete blocks come in many shapes, with sash concrete blocks featuring slots cut into the flat end. Sash concrete blocks are often used around window and door openings. Single corner concrete blocks are "L" shaped with one corner, while double corner brick blocks are designed to be vertical.

Pavers & Patio

There are many different types of pavers and patio stones and choosing the right one can make all the difference in the look of your home. These materials are extremely easy to maintain. Simply sweep off any dirt, and use water and a mild soap to clean them. When pavers begin to crack, they should be replaced. It's also important to seal them once a year to protect against the elements. In addition, if weeds are growing in between the pavers, you can spray them with a natural weed killer that won't harm the porous stone.

Stone Walls & General Stone Work

When building stone walls, you will have many options for the stone you use. Old weathered rock, for example, has a range of sizes, shapes, and textures. Some of these stones are natural and aged, while others are reclaimed from an old stone building or wall. Either way, they will give your wall a rustic look. Blocky, large rocks are an attractive choice, as they are easy to fit together and can be used in combination with smaller stones to create a natural and attractive look.
